lol
1{stdenv, fetchurl, xorg, automake, autoconf, libtool, makeOverridable}:
2{
3 xf86videoati = {src, suffix}:
4 makeOverridable stdenv.mkDerivation {
5 name = "xf86-video-ati-${suffix}";
6 buildInputs = xorg.xf86videoati.buildInputs ++
7 [autoconf automake libtool];
8 builder = ./builder.sh;
9 inherit src;
10 preConfigure = ''
11 export NIX_CFLAGS_COMPILE="$NIX_CFLAGS_COMPILE -DPACKAGE_VERSION_MAJOR=6"
12 export NIX_CFLAGS_COMPILE="$NIX_CFLAGS_COMPILE -DPACKAGE_VERSION_MINOR=9"
13 export NIX_CFLAGS_COMPILE="$NIX_CFLAGS_COMPILE -DPACKAGE_VERSION_PATCHLEVEL=999"
14
15 sed -e 's/@DRIVER_MAN_SUFFIX@/man/g' -i man/Makefile.am
16 export DRIVER_MAN_DIR=$out/share/man/man5
17
18 ./autogen.sh
19 '';
20 };
21}